Originally Posted by fromthe5 View Post
If you're trying to rank for very competitive terms you will likely wait forever to attain good rankings using only internal links.
Yep, it could take a long time or it can be speeded up too, depends entirely on the search engine marketing strategy. In the meantime, it is impossible not to acquire some incoming links, it happens naturally to some degree. If a webpage can ammass a volume of naturally generated links it can speed up the process of attaining credibilty and importance even more.

There is no doubt though, highly optimized well-crafted webpage/websites fair better in the SERPs, their rankings are easier to maintain and their market share of qualified traffic evolves as the web site promotion grows.

The one thing we need to know before giving you an educated reply is what is your site about-is it a free hosted site or a paid domain etc.

All these things factor in-leaving out the moral questions and thinking only in terms of results.
For example-if you are using blogspot or any free hosted site then it matters not of you get 10000 PR4 links pointing to you-you can not get PageRank.

Using forums,leaving comments on ranked sites etc,all these things will bring yopu more traffic and help others find you in SE much better then paying for backlinks.

I earn from people buying links on some of my sites,but would never risk my ranking on my main sites by selling them through any paid service.

A good site with a good niche,original content can get ranking and great search traffic without ever paying a dime to anyone.
If you do not have those things going for you then perhaps pay for some links will help in the short term-but never for long
